Meaning of throw bag in English:

throw bag


  • 1A piece of life-saving equipment comprising a lightweight fabric bag which pays out a length of rope when thrown, used to rescue people in difficulties in the water.

  • 2A small weighted pouch designed to be attached to a lightweight rope and thrown or launched over a high tree branch, in order to position a climbing or rigging line in a tree.